Teams are really defined now by the type of player they play at the 1 and the 5. Everyone else 2-4, ideally, would be a long athletic, 2-way wing. So it's really a question of what style of center the Jazz are envisioning.

The best bang for the buck at the center position in this draft is probably Chomche. He's got the size, length and physicality to have an impact, plus there's a bit of passing and shooting touch to work with. He'll probably go in the 2nd half of the 1st round.

Otherwise, Kyle Filipowski could probably come in, develop and be similar to a Jusuf Nurkic maybe--someone who will move the ball, finish plays, space the floor a bit and play positional defense, if not guard the rim.

I just get the sense that the Jazz want to space the floor and create lanes for passing and cutting. I think the fact that the Jazz keep bringing Kessler off the bench is telling. I don't think it's just a matter of trying to build John Collins' trade value. I think they want everyone to be able to shoot and attack open space.
